Echoes of the Gold Rush: A Cautionary Tale

Consider the California Gold Rush of the mid-1800s, where many flocked westward in search of wealth only to realize that often the true gains came not from mining but from selling tools and resources to desperate prospectors. Similarly, in the crypto game, the real winners may emerge not as players racking up earnings but as developers and marketers capitalizing on the fervor surrounding digital currencies. Just like the gold diggers faced hurdles and revelations, todayโ€™s players may also find that their path to riches is fraught with questions about sustainability and real value, not unlike those who once sought fortunes in the rocky hills of California.
